Plugins for the Fernhaven greenhouse controller must compensate for sensor drift using the shared calibration tables rather than hardcoded offsets. Each humidity and temperature probe accumulates a drift profile, recalculated nightly from reference readings. To develop locally, run the sandbox controller with a seeded drift dataset so your plugin sees realistic correction curves rather than flat zeros. The seed script expects the calibration database to be reachable; it reads the connection string shown below.

primary connection of yagep-kahip = redis://giliel_svc:zYiKsLL2PLpfPL@db-348f.xolmarsys.corp:5432/fenwyn

Action item: The Relayn deploy-status bot silently dropped updates when the pipeline API paginated results, so responders believed a rollback had completed when it had not. We will add pagination handling, a staleness banner, and an integration test. Until merged, verify deploy state directly in the pipeline console, documented at the page below.

runbook for kahop-kajop: https://rundeck.ordinio.test/display/secrets/pipeline/issue/pages/repo/browse/e5732776e07d1285107e5aeb

Handover note for new joiners: offline mode in the Trailmark survey app stores responses in an encrypted local journal and syncs opportunistically via the Ridgeline gateway. Watch for clock-skew issues on older tablets — they can reorder submissions during reconciliation. I've documented the workarounds we use in the field. The full sync troubleshooting guide lives on the internal page below.

runbook for hawif-tajeg: https://grafana.plorvasoft.example/dash